Obituary for Raymond Lee Welch

Raymond Lee Welch, "Ray", aged 79, of Austin, Texas, passed away February 6, 2023, at Ascension Seton Medical Center Hays in Kyle, Texas. Ray was born in Emporia, Kansas on November 2, 1943, to Raymond Ward Welch and Irene Fooshee Welch.

Ray graduated from Augusta High School in Augusta, Kansas in 1961 where he met his high school sweetheart, Nancy Wheeler. Ray and Nancy were married in 1964 while he was completing a Bachelor of Arts in Chemistry at Emporia State University. He obtained his doctorate in Organic Chemistry from Iowa State University in 1969. He and Nancy then moved to Wilmington, Delaware, where he was a research chemist for Hercules Chemical Company. Ray's daughters, Lara and Janna, were born in Wilmington, where Ray and Nancy stayed to raise their family.

In the 1980's, Ray and several colleagues bought out the magnetic coatings division of Hercules to create Magnox, Inc. Ray and Nancy moved to Radford, Virginia where they lived for 15 years. This transition gave Ray the opportunity to travel the world as a technical specialist for the company. Nancy was able to travel with him on these trips annually and he even brought the girls with him once to explore Japan, Korea, Singapore, Hong Kong and Taiwan.

After spending 25 years in the chemical industry, Ray retired and decided to pursue a Masters Degree in Business Administration from Radford University where he finished the degree and eventually became an adjunct professor. Ray and Nancy spent the next two decades travelling for pleasure and exploring 6 continents. Ray loved cars and they additionally took a 13,000 mile car trip through the western USA and Canada in his beloved blue Porsche Boxster. Ray and Nancy eventually retired to Sun City, Texas, where they made new friends, enjoyed the hiking club, playing poker, making beer, playing golf, and spending time with their grandchildren.

Ray is survived by his wife of 58 years, Nancy, of Austin, Texas, his brother, Wesley Welch of Leawood, Kansas, daughters Lara Borne (Stephen) of Camp Hill, Pennsylvania, and Janna Welch Warner (Benjamin) of Austin, Texas, grandchildren, Brendan, Kevin and Natalie Borne and Isaac and Nathaniel Warner, and nephews and Cole and Matthew Welch and niece Meghan Dahl.
